Key responsibilities & accountabilities:

  • Support the design and development of mechanical components, assemblies, and systems used in pumps, and water technology products.
  • Prepare and modify 2D drawings and 3D models using Creo and other CAD tools.
  • Create and maintain engineering drawings, specifications, and technical documentation in accordance with company standards.
  • Interpret customer specifications, engineering requirements, and industry standards.
  • Assist in the preparation and maintenance of Bills of Materials (BOMs) within ERP systems.
  • Apply Geometric Dimensioning & Tolerancing (GD&T) principles to engineering drawings.
  • Participate in product validation, prototype evaluations, and design reviews.
  • Support engineering change requests and product improvement initiatives.
  • Collaborate with manufacturing, sourcing, operations, quality, and global engineering teams to ensure successful product execution.
  • Assist in troubleshooting engineering and manufacturing issues and recommend practical solutions.
  • Support documentation activities associated with engineering releases and product lifecycle management.
  • Learn and apply engineering best practices, design standards, and product development processes.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ives focused on quality, productivity, and innovation.

Xylem |ˈzīləm| 1) The tissue in plants that brings water upward from the roots; 2) a leading global water technology company. Xylem, a leading global water technology company dedicated to solving the world’s most challenging water issues, is the leading global provider of efficient, innovative and sustainable water technologies improving the way water is used, managed, conserved and re-used.
